Jury finds List not guilty of abuse

DANVILLE — Four days after walking into the courtroom as a man charged with sexual assault, Mark List of Danville left Vermilion County Courthouse exonerated.

A jury deliberated for almost three hours before returning a verdict around 5:30 p.m. of not guilty on three charges List faced charges of aggravated criminal sexual abuse, criminal sexual assault in a position of trust and indecent solicitation of a child.

Danville police arrested List in January 2010 based on accusations he sexually abused a student at Danville Christian Academy while List was an associate pastor there.

Defense attorney David Ryan said Friday night he was grateful for the jury’s verdict in the case.
